Universal Insurance Holdings, Inc. (UVE) - VRIO Analysis: Strong Regional Insurance Presence

Value: Targeted Insurance Solutions

Universal Insurance Holdings operates primarily in Florida, with 92% of its business concentrated in the state's property insurance market. The company generated $1.04 billion in total revenue in 2022.

Market Metric Value
Florida Market Share 8.7%
Total Policies 1,237,000
Average Policy Value $2,350

Rarity: Regional Specialization

Universal Insurance Holdings demonstrates moderate regional specialization with $687 million in direct written premiums for Florida residential properties in 2022.

  • Focused on catastrophe-exposed regions
  • Specialized in high-risk property insurance
  • Limited national geographic footprint

Inimitability: Local Market Knowledge

The company has 27 years of continuous operation in Florida, with deep understanding of local risk patterns. Proprietary risk assessment models cover 98% of Florida's counties.

Risk Assessment Metric Coverage
Geographic Risk Models 98%
Catastrophe Modeling Accuracy 94%

Organization: Distribution Strategy

Universal Insurance maintains 672 independent agent partnerships across Florida. Distribution network generates $412 million in annual premium volume.

  • Centralized underwriting teams
  • Advanced risk assessment technology
  • Efficient claims processing infrastructure

Competitive Advantage

Temporary competitive advantage with $146 million in net income for 2022, representing 14.1% return on equity in the Florida property insurance market.
